Anatomical variations of the abducent nerve in humans.
Archivio italiano di anatomia e di embriologia. Italian journal of anatomy and embryology - 1 Jan 2000
DiDio L J, Baptista C A, Teofilovski-Parapid G
Abstract excerpt
Anatomical variation of the nervus abducens in human encephali were found and described. They consisted of (1) an unusual trifurcation of the abducent nerve, limited to the extradural portion of the neural trunk (1.4% of the cases) and (2) the duplicity (11.1%) of the neural trunk, starting befor...
